Rep. Angie Nixon and Sen. Ashley Moody prepare for U.S. Senate general election
Following a primary election victory, Democratic candidate Angie Nixon is challenging Republican incumbent Ashley Moody for a U.S. Senate seat. Nixon secured 56% of the vote in the primary despite being outfundraised 16-to-1 by primary opponent Alexander Vindman.

Key Facts
- Angie Nixon won the Democratic U.S. Senate primary with 56% of the vote.
- Ashley Moody is the Republican incumbent for the U.S. Senate seat.
- Ashley Moody received 80% of the vote in her primary election.
- Alexander Vindman outfundraised Angie Nixon by a ratio of 16-to-1 during the primary.
